How Non GamStop Casinos Differ

The core difference is regulatory control. UK-licensed sites must follow strict rules on bonus sizes, wagering requirements, and maximum stakes. Non GamStop casinos answer to their own regulators, so they can offer larger welcome packages, higher table limits, and more generous cashback deals. They also tend to support cryptocurrency payments, which adds a layer of privacy that UK sites rarely provide.

Safety and Responsible Gambling

Even outside the UK system, responsible gambling tools exist. Deposit lim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ion are managed internally by each casino. They aren’t linked to a national database, so you must set these limits yourself on every site you use. If you’re prone to chasing losses, that lack of centralisation is a risk, not a feature.

Licensing also matters for dispute resolution. If a non GamStop casino cheats you, the UK Gambling Commission won’t step in. Your only recourse is the international regulator that issued the licence. That’s why sticking with well-known licences and established operators is non-negotiable.
